How it works

How pathway jet washing works in Clapham

Five steps, the same on every SW4 job, so you know what happens before you commit.   1. Step 1

    Tell us the surface and the access

    Concrete, natural stone or block paving, roughly the length, and whether residents need the path kept open throughout.

  2. Step 2

    Fixed written quote

    Priced as a flat rate under 10m² or per square metre above it, with a communal walkway quoted per visit for the access constraints it involves.

  3. Step 3

    Pre-treat algae and lichen

    Shaded, north-facing stretches usually carry the heaviest growth and get a biocide soak before the pressure wash, so it doesn't simply regrow within weeks.

  4. Step 4

    Wash at the right pressure

    Full pressure on concrete and tarmac; a hand lance and reduced pressure on York stone, sandstone and other natural flags to avoid pitting the surface.

  5. Step 5

    Sign, dry and hand back

    Wet-floor signs stay out until the path is safe, then debris is swept and the route reopened.

Pathway jet washing prices in Clapham

Fixed prices for SW4 and the rest of Lambeth. Surface and access, not length alone. Natural stone at a lower pressure takes longer per square metre than concrete, and a communal path that must stay open for residents costs more than a private one of the same size.
Pathway jet washing price guide for Clapham SW4
JobFromTypical timeWhat sets the price
Front path, up to 10m²£8540–60 minPriced as a flat job below 10m² because the van and hose have to be set up regardless of the path's length.
Concrete or tarmac path, per m² over 10m²£4By areaA straightforward, non-porous surface that takes full pressure without risk to the finish.
York stone or natural flag path, per m²£6By areaNatural stone is softer and more porous than concrete flags, so it's cleaned with a lower pressure and a hand lance rather than a rotary surface cleaner.
Block-paved path, per m²£5By areaNarrow paths have proportionally more joint length than a driveway of the same area, so more of the job is joint work rather than open-surface passes.
Communal walkway or shared side return, per visit£150By lengthPriced per visit rather than per square metre because access has to be kept open for residents throughout, which slows the run compared with a private path.
Anti-slip treatment application, per m²£3.50Added to visitA surface treatment applied after cleaning that increases grip on stone and concrete, priced separately because not every path needs it.

Domestic prices are the total you pay; managing agents and freeholders are invoiced plus VAT at 20%. Debris clearance, a rinse of adjoining thresholds and hazard signage while the surface dries are included. Where the path is on adopted highway and a licence is needed to work on it, that cost is itemised before booking.

Not included

  • Re-laying, re-bedding or replacing cracked, sunken or missing flags — quoted separately as paving repair, handled by London Borough of Lambeth or a specialist contractor instead
  • Repointing natural stone joints on listed or conservation-area surfaces, which needs a mason working to the borough's conservation guidance, which we refer on to the right trade in Clapham
  • Adopted public highway sections that need a council street-works licence before any work can start, outside the fixed price on Clapham bookings
  • Removing tree root heave that has lifted a path, which needs an arborist assessment first, and we will say so before the SW4 visit rather than on the day
